This is a Notice of Intent, not a request for proposal. The National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Diseases (NIAID) of the National Institutes of Health (NIH) intends to negotiate on an other than full and open competition basis with Psomagen, Inc. for total RNA sequencing with an option to increase. Due to continuity protocols, and to avoid introducing variables in the testing results, we must use the same source throughout the life of the study.
The National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Diseases (NIAID), has a study to sequence RNA obtained from the PBMC’s of the same set of patients whose nasal epithelium was earlier sequenced. The purpose of this research is to understand transcriptomics signatures of asthma and asthma severity in the African Diaspora.
The RNASeq generated from the PBMCs will be compared to RNASeq generated from nasal epithelium on the same study subjects to allow NIAID to identify common and unique signatures from two different target tissues relevant to this disease. Psomagen has sequenced the RNA samples that were obtained from the Nasal epithelium from the subjects in the CAAPA study. For the uniformity and comparability, NIAID request to use Psomagen to sequence the PBMC samples so as the expand on the pre-existing resources in CAAPA.
